1. Distance of the Move

The distance between your current home and the new one is a key factor in determining the cost of your move. Local moves are typically cheaper than long-distance or cross-country moves.

2. Weight of Your Belongings

The total weight of your belongings also contributes significantly to the moving cost. Moving companies often charge based on the importance of the items to be transported, which means the more stuff you have, the higher your moving cost.

3. Time of the Move

The time of your move can also affect the cost. Moving services are often in high demand during the summer, on weekends, and at the end of the month. Consider moving during off-peak times to lower your moving costs.

4. Additional Services

Additional services such as packing, disassembling furniture, or providing storage can add to the cost of your move. Make sure to inquire about the cost of these services when getting a quote.

5. Insurance Coverage

Most moving companies offer basic liability coverage included in the cost. However, consider purchasing additional coverage for peace of mind, especially if you have valuable items. Remember, this will add to your overall moving cost.

6. Unexpected Costs

Unexpected costs can arise during the move, such as custom crating fees for delicate items, stair fees if your movers must navigate flights of stairs, or extended carry fees if your movers have to carry items a significant distance from your home to the moving truck. It’s essential to discuss these potential costs with your moving service beforehand.

7. Tipping Your Movers

While it’s not a mandatory cost, tipping your movers for their hard work is customary and should be factored into your moving budget. A typical tip is around 10-20% of the moving cost, divided among the crew.
